Innovations in Auto Parts: How Technology is Reshaping the Industry

The auto parts industry is undergoing significant transformations driven by technological advancements. These innovations are not only enhancing the performance of vehicles but also improving their reliability and efficiency. This article explores some of the most noteworthy technological trends impacting auto parts manufacturing.

1. 3D Printing in Auto Parts Manufacturing

3D printing technology allows for rapid prototyping and production of complex auto parts. This innovation significantly reduces costs and lead times, enabling manufacturers to produce parts on demand and minimize inventory.

2. Advanced Safety Features

With the growing emphasis on vehicle safety, many auto parts are being designed with advanced safety features. Components like reinforced bumpers, adaptive headlights, and smart airbags are becoming standard, enhancing overall vehicle safety.

3. Integration of AI and Machine Learning

Artificial Intelligence (AI) and machine learning are being integrated into the design and testing processes of auto parts. AI can predict component failures, optimize designs, and improve manufacturing efficiencies, thereby reducing overall costs.

4. Enhanced Performance through Smart Technology

Smart technology is making its way into various auto parts, including engines and braking systems. These components can communicate with other vehicle systems, providing real-time data to enhance performance and maintenance schedules.

5. Sustainable Manufacturing Practices

As environmental concerns grow, manufacturers are adopting sustainable practices in producing auto parts. This includes using recycled materials and eco-friendly production techniques that minimize waste and carbon footprints.
